Official DOL plan name: Retirement Savings Plan for Employees of Continental - Automotive Systems · Sponsored by Continental Automotive, Inc. · South Carolina · Manufacturing
$1.0B in assets, 2,997 participants
Continental Automotive, Inc.'s Retirement Savings Plan for Employees of Continental - Automotive Systems reported $1.0B in total assets and 2,997 participants in its 2023 DOL Form 5500 filing, ranking in the 99th percentile by assets among filed plans. Figures are as reported by the plan sponsor to the Department of Labor, not audited or endorsed by PlainRetire.

What changed between DOL Form 5500 filings
plan year 2022 → plan year 2023
- Retirement Savings Plan for Employees of Continental - Automotive Systems reported net income rose from -$250M in the plan year 2022 filing to $128M in the plan year 2023 filing.
- Retirement Savings Plan for Employees of Continental - Automotive Systems end-of-year assets rose from $878M in the plan year 2022 filing to $1.0B in the plan year 2023 filing.
- Retirement Savings Plan for Employees of Continental - Automotive Systems reported participants fell from 3,143 in the plan year 2022 filing to 2,997 in the plan year 2023 filing.
